The Franciscan Sisters of Little Falls, Minnesota, are beginning a search for a full-time Pastoral/Spiritual Care Manager. The Manager provides spiritual and emotional support by active listening, compassionate caring support to Sisters and lay staff. The ability to be truly present to others. Establish a good rapport within an environment of hospitality, peace, and spirituality, promoting the well-being of the body, mind, and spirit of each Sister. It is a ministry of presence and active/attentive listening. The full position description is listed below. Benefits begin the first of the month following start date. Benefits include health, dental, vision, and life insurance; vacation, sick, holiday pay; 403(b) retirement; free membership to St. Francis Health & Wellness. Hours per week: 40 Starting wage: $26.00 - $28.00 per hour WHO ARE THE FRANCISCAN SISTERS OF LITTLE FALLS, MN? We are a Roman Catholic congregation of 72 women religious of the Third Order of St. Francis of Assisi. We walk in relationship with Associates, an intergenerational group of men and women who want to know and live the Gospel life as Francis and Clare of Assisi modeled for us. We dedicate ourselves to living joyfully through the Franciscan value of ongoing conversion through which flows contemplative prayer, living simply in God s generosity and serving others, especially those living on the margins. We are committed to a life of prayer, simple living, and service to those in need. We are dedicated to promoting human rights, building community wherever we live, and healing the sources of Mother Earth s wounds. TO APPLY OR LEARN MORE

  • Description of Role Provides spiritual and emotional support by active listening, compassionate caring support to Sisters and Lay staff. The ability to be truly present to others. Establish a good rapport within an environment of hospitality, peace, and spirituality, promoting the well-being of the body, mind, and spirit of each Sister. It is a ministry of presence and active/attentive listening.
  • Major and Minor Tasks
  • Knows and demonstrates the four Franciscan Employee Core Values of respect, open communication, hospitality, and compassion while performing all job functions. Demonstrates values with other staff, volunteers, clients, and visitors.
  • Demonstrates openness to learning Franciscan spirituality, including the core values of ongoing conversion, contemplative prayer, evangelical humility, and evangelical poverty, to better serve and support the work of the Franciscan Sisters of Little Falls.
  • Upholds and fulfills the mission and philosophy of Franciscan Sisters in all areas of communications and public relations, whether written or spoken.
  • Possesses an overall understanding of the pastoral needs among the Franciscan Sisters on campus.
  • Responsible for providing retreats to Sisters (Annual Religious retreats, and the retreats to meet the needs of the Sisters)
  • Provides or arranges for spiritual growth opportunities, Bible study, faith sharing, discussions, small group sharing, as needed by the Sisters.
  • Assures that Sisters can attend religious services that are m aningful to them, i.e., Mass, Rosary, retreats.
  • Conducts a spiritual assessment for each Sister (Convent, 2nd, and 3rd floor) and keeps a current Spiritual Care Plan for each.
  • Gives priority to those experiencing loss, grief, transition, or impending death.
  • Plans for prayer services/anointing of a Sister when approaching death.
  • Assist with preliminary and actual funeral planning of Sisters funerals and serve as back-up.
  • Adapts spiritual offerings to the needs of those with memory loss.
  • Keeps Sisters informed about spiritual offerings/retreats at other locations, such as St. John s, etc.
  • Communicates with other disciplines when needed, i.e., supportive companion, spiritual director, hospice, health care coordinator.
  • Encourages Sisters to connect with the natural world around them.
  • Supervises volunteers assisting with pastoral care.
  • Member of the Liturgy Committee.
  • Other duties as assigned.
  • Qualifications Ability to be a compassionate presence to the sisters. Ability to read non-verbal signals, ability to provide a listening presence and spiritual support. Familiarity with and/or willingness to learn about Franciscan spirituality. Effective communication, organizational and time management skills. A collaborative approach to working with colleagues. Skilled in accompaniment with the elderly, the dying, those in distress. Maintains confidentiality.
  • Performance Requirements Clinical Pastoral Education, Professional Certificate in Spiritual Gerontology or an equivalent combination of education and experience sufficient to perform the principal duties of the position. Minimum of 3-5 years pastoral experience preferably with the elderly or in healthcare/long term care setting.
